About Constantin Enea
Constantin Enea is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Artificial Intelligence, Computational Theory and Mathematics, Hardware and Architecture and Information Systems, having authored 45 papers that have together received 190 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Distributed systems and fault tolerance (20 papers), Formal Methods in Verification (15 papers), Logic, programming, and type systems (12 papers), Software System Performance and Reliability (9 papers), Security and Verification in Computing (6 papers),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(5 papers), Logic, Reasoning, and Knowledge (4 papers) and Embedded Systems Design Techniques (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hardware and Architecture (44 citations), Computer Networks and Communications (124 citations), Software (20 citations), Computational Theory and Mathematics (59 citations) and Artificial Intelligence (93 citations). Constantin Enea has collaborated with scholars based in France, United States and Romania. Frequent co-authors include Ahmed Bouajjani, Michael Emmi, Dimitar P. Guelev, Cătălin Dima, Rachid Guerraoui, Mihaela Sighireanu, Ferucio Laurenţiu Ţiplea, Ioana Boureanu, Rupak Majumdar and Ondřej Lengál.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the ACM on Programming Languages, ACM SIGPLAN Notices, Formal Methods in System Design, Information and Computation and Journal of Computer Security.
